Julian was appointed Group General Counsel and Chief Compliance Officer of Survitec in November 2019. In addition to in-house skills, he has considerable international experience and has handled a wide range of legal and business situations in a variety of industries. Following qualification as a barrister in 1994, Julian held in-house positions at Rhône-Poulenc, British American Tobacco, GE, and Baltimore Technologies. Prior to joining Survitec, he was the General Counsel and Company Secretary of London Stock Exchange-listed Thalassa Holdings, a diversified holding company.
Julian holds law degrees from King’s College London and Université de Paris I, Panthéon-Sorbonne, as well as an MBA from London Business School.

Survitec is a global leader in survival and safety solutions to the marine, defence, aviation and offshore markets. Survitec has over 3,000 employees worldwide covering 8 manufacturing facilities, 15 offshore support centres and over 70 owned service stations. It is further supported by a network of over 500 3rd party service stations and distributors. Across its 160-year history, Survitec Group has remained at the forefront of innovation, design and application engineering and is the trusted name when it comes to critical safety and survival solutions
